James Pizzo Obituary

James Mario Pizzo, Sr. of Audubon Pennsylvania, passed away on January 4, 2025. He was 79 years old. Jim was born February 8, 1945, in Philadelphia to Grace and Eugene Pizzo. He is survived by his loving wife of 58 years, Elaine (nee Vento); sons, James M. Pizzo, Jr. (Valerie), and Damian Pizzo (Jennifer); grandchildren, Isabella Grace, Hunter James, and Mia Faith; siblings, Eugene (Joan), Carol McIntyre (James), Mark (Lhorie), Ron (Kate), Rita Ackert (Robert), Rick (Caroline); sister-in-law, Janet Chambers (Warren); and many nieces and nephews.
James was a 1962 graduate of Lansdale Catholic High School. James graduated from The Bryland Institute of Cosmetology, Charles of the Ritz School of Advanced Hair Design, and Vidal Sassoon Academies (London, San Francisco, and Toronto). He was an entrepreneur who owned and operated several hair salons (James Mario's Hair Fashions, Family Krimpers, and Looks Inc.) since the age of 19. James has taught nationally and has been published in numerous international hair design magazines. He was a self-taught artist who mastered many mediums including photography, wood sculpting, painting, jewelry, and Japanese bonsai gardens. His ability to master all that he attempted earned him the nickname of the Renaissance Man.
James enjoyed traveling with his family from coast to coast and celebrating many milestones together. He cherished the time he spent with Elaine most, but also his family, grandchildren, and friends. We thank you all for being a special part of the fabric of his life and legacy.
